ASP连接Oracle的方式有几种, 这里介绍一下 OLE 连接方法
dim objConn,strConn,DBServer,DBName,DBUser,DBPassword
dim RS,xSQL
DBServer="192.168.1.151" '//DB Server
DBName="oracleDB" '//登陆数据库名/SID
DBUser="system" '//登陆用户名
DBPassword="123456" '//登陆用户密码
err.clear
on error resume next
'//------------------start: oracle DB connect----------------------
'// ORACLE 数据库连接方法
'//----------------------------------------------------------------
set objConn=server.CreateObject("adodb.connection")
'Oracle OLE DB 连接方法:[ok] '//DB和IIS同在一个服务器上时
strConn="Provider=OraOLEDB.Oracle;User ID=" & DBUser & ";Password=" & DBPassword & ";Data Source=" & DBName '//& ";server=" & DBServer
objConn.open strConn
if err.number<>0 then
response.Write "
Error description: " & err.description
end if
'//--------------------end: oracle DB connect----------------------
'//-----------------数据查询-----------------
xSQL="select empno,ename,sal from scott.emp"
set RS=server.CreateObject("adodb.recordset")
RS.open xSQL,objConn,1,1
'//....code....
%> 更多连接方法可以网上搜索, 这里是是在俺电脑上测试通过的结果